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Brixton, England and Tower Hamlets, Greater London,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Stockwell station to London Bridge station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2–3 and the journey takes 10 min. Alternatively, Go Ahead London operates a bus from Denmark Hill /Camberwell Green to Tower Gateway every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£1–20 and the journey takes 30 min. Abellio London also services this route hourly.
